資源描述:
《畢業(yè)設(shè)計(論文)-基于MVC的課程管理系統(tǒng)的設(shè)計與實現(xiàn)》由會員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在工程資料-天天文庫。
1、【摘要】幾年前,各個學(xué)校的學(xué)生成績管理基本上都是靠手工進(jìn)行,隨著學(xué)校的規(guī)模增大,有關(guān)學(xué)生成績管理工作所涉及的數(shù)據(jù)量越來越大,有的學(xué)校不得不靠增加人力、物力來進(jìn)行學(xué)牛成績管理。但手工管理具有效率底、易出錯、檢索信息慢、對學(xué)校的管理提供決策信息較為困難等缺點(diǎn)。因此,使用效率更高的方式來處理這些數(shù)據(jù)就更顯得重要了。本文就該系統(tǒng)進(jìn)行分析和整體的介紹,并介紹了使用JSP+SQLSERVER技術(shù)開發(fā)該系統(tǒng)的相關(guān)模塊的整個過程。該系統(tǒng)主要利用了JSP強(qiáng)大的網(wǎng)絡(luò)數(shù)據(jù)庫訪問技術(shù),與SQLSERVER的強(qiáng)大的數(shù)據(jù)庫功能來實現(xiàn)主要功能。系統(tǒng)設(shè)計并實現(xiàn)了學(xué)生選報課程,教師給接
2、受學(xué)牛所報課程并給學(xué)牛打分、管理員后臺管理的功能?!娟P(guān)鍵詞】JSPSQLSERVER課程管理MVCDesignandImplementationofOnlineRecruitmentSystem[Abstract]ThedevelopmentofmodernInformationTechnologyhavebroughtmodernsanewshoppingmode,whichiskindofInternetOrderPlatformbasedonWebtechnology.Thus,Ticket&DiningReservationSystemwill
3、notonlysavetheairlinecompany'scost,butalsoprovidebetterserviceforthecustomers.Inthisarticle,theauthorwillanalyzehisinvolvedpartofthesystemandintroducethesystemwholly.ThewholeprocedureofexploitingthesystembyemployingJSP+SQLSERVER2000technologywillbeintroduced?Thesystem^keyfunctio
4、nsareimplementedbyemployingJSP'sInternetDatabaseVisitingTechnologyandSQLSERVER2000,sDataBaseFunction.ThesystemdesignsandrealizesthefunctionsincludingUserLoggingandRegistration,FoodDemonstrationandReservation,FlightTrackerandForum[Keywords1JSP,SQLSERVER2000,curriculummanagement,M
5、VC第一章緒論11.1論文研究主要內(nèi)容11.2國內(nèi)外現(xiàn)狀2第二章需求分析42.1JSP概述42.2MVC介紹52.3SQL語言概述6第三章數(shù)據(jù)庫設(shè)計83.1數(shù)據(jù)庫詳細(xì)設(shè)計83.1.1系統(tǒng)功能概述133.1.2系統(tǒng)各模塊功能概述143.2系統(tǒng)開發(fā)環(huán)境153.3系統(tǒng)可行性分析153.3.1技術(shù)可行性153.3.2系統(tǒng)安全可行性16第四章技術(shù)介紹174.1開發(fā)語言選擇174.1.1指導(dǎo)思想204.1.2軟件設(shè)計原則204.2系統(tǒng)構(gòu)架設(shè)計204.3系統(tǒng)的功能結(jié)構(gòu)設(shè)計214.3.1登錄模塊214.3.2學(xué)生用戶功能模塊214.3.3教師用戶功能模塊224.3.4
6、管理員用戶功能模塊22第五章系統(tǒng)實現(xiàn)245.1登錄首頁245.2學(xué)生用戶功能實現(xiàn)255.2.1學(xué)生用戶登錄到系統(tǒng)首頁255.2.2注冊課程262.2.3更改個人信息273.2.4查看成績283.3教師用戶功能實現(xiàn)283.3.1教師登錄首頁283.3.2選擇學(xué)生295.4管理員用戶功能實現(xiàn)305.4.1管理員登錄首頁305.4.2學(xué)生維護(hù)305.4.3教師維護(hù)31第六章總結(jié)336.1用戶登錄模塊功能測試344.2其它模塊功能測試34參考文獻(xiàn)36致謝37附錄一38第一章緒論現(xiàn)在我國的大中專院校的學(xué)牛課程管理水平普遍不高,有的還停留在紙介質(zhì)基礎(chǔ)上,這種管理手
7、段己不能適應(yīng)時代的發(fā)展,因為它浪費(fèi)了了許多的人力和物力。在當(dāng)今信息時代這種傳統(tǒng)的管理方法必然被計算機(jī)為基礎(chǔ)的信息管理系統(tǒng)所代替。如果本系統(tǒng)能被學(xué)校所采用,將會改變以前靠手工管理學(xué)牛課程的狀況,可以樹立良好的辦學(xué)形象,提高工作效率。網(wǎng)上選課系統(tǒng)己成為教學(xué)教務(wù)管理面向?qū)W生的重要部分。當(dāng)前高等院校正逐步實施學(xué)分制,其特點(diǎn)是學(xué)生按照選定專業(yè)的培養(yǎng)計劃修完規(guī)定的課程并獲得相應(yīng)的學(xué)分即可取得相應(yīng)學(xué)位或?qū)W歷,而對學(xué)習(xí)年限沒有規(guī)定。實行學(xué)分制管理,允許學(xué)牛在一定范圍內(nèi)選擇適合自己需要的課程,具有相當(dāng)分散性、時間不確定性,難于人工調(diào)配與集中管理。另外由于目前教學(xué)資源比較
8、緊張,對課程的修課人數(shù)、修課條件等都有限制,這無疑增加了選課管理難度和教務(wù)管理人員的工作量。傳